Transaction 376e60ae37b18a5a0ee4df42c522d6c2c1072f3dd72a55a63906b4cf83130d7d

1 Input
1 Outputs
  • 376e60ae37b18a5a0ee4df42c522d6c2c1072f3dd72a55a63906b4cf83130d7d:0
  • value  257933
    address  1M2CzE4b6pWskZPVTmgZDRuXfNaFqDYs9d